Roof exhaust installation services involve the placement and setup of venting systems on the roof to facilitate proper airflow and ventilation within a building. These systems often include exhaust vents, fans, and hoods that are designed to remove heat, moisture, fumes, or odors from indoor spaces. Proper installation ensures that air can circulate effectively, helping to maintain a comfortable and healthy environment inside residential, commercial, or industrial properties. Skilled contractors assess the building’s structure and ventilation needs to determine the most suitable locations and types of exhaust systems for optimal performance.
One of the primary issues that roof exhaust installation addresses is poor indoor air quality caused by inadequate ventilation. Without proper exhaust systems, excess moisture can accumulate, leading to issues like mold growth, wood rot, and structural damage. Additionally, in spaces such as kitchens, workshops, or industrial facilities, fumes, smoke, and airborne contaminants can pose health risks if not properly vented outside. Installing effective roof exhaust systems helps mitigate these problems by removing harmful substances and maintaining a balanced indoor environment, which can also contribute to energy efficiency by reducing the load on heating and cooling systems.
Various types of properties benefit from roof exhaust installation, including residential homes, commercial buildings, and industrial facilities. Homes with attics or ventilation needs for kitchens and bathrooms often require exhaust vents to prevent moisture buildup and improve air circulation. Commercial properties, such as restaurants or warehouses, frequently need specialized exhaust systems to handle smoke, fumes, or heat generated during operations. Industrial sites may require heavy-duty exhaust solutions to manage airborne pollutants or heat generated by machinery. Material and Design Costs - The cost for roof exhaust installation varies based on the type of materials and design complexity, typically ranging from $300 to $1,200. Basic fan units and standard roofing materials tend to be on the lower end, while custom designs increase expenses. Local pros can provide precise estimates based on specific project requirements.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ing roof exhaust systems generally fall between $200 and $800, depending on roof height, accessibility, and system complexity. More intricate installations or high roofs may incur higher labor charges. Contact local service providers for detailed quotes tailored to specific properties.
Permitting and Inspection Fees - Permitting and inspection fees can add approximately $50 to $300 to the overall project cost, depending on local regulations in Highland Park, NJ. Some areas may include these fees in the contractor's overall estimate, while others require separate payments. Local pros can clarify permit requirements and associated costs.
Additional Equipment and Accessories - Costs for additional components such as ductwork, vents, or control systems typically range from $100 to $500. The inclusion of these accessories can influence the total installation expense. Pros can help determine necessary accessories and provide comprehensive cost est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
